An online interest calculator is a web-based tool designed to provide users with instant computations of interest payments on loans based on specified criteria. These calculators are user-friendly and can handle various interest types, including simple and compound interest. By inputting details such as principal amount, interest rate, and loan term, users can receive quick estimates without complex manual calculations. Interest calculator comes in many forms, catering to specific financial needs, such as mortgage calculators, car loan calculators, and student loan calculators, among others. Each type is tailored to offer users a comprehensive view of repayment plans, helping them make informed decisions about borrowing and managing debt. The Role of a Compound Interest Calculator Understanding Compound Interest Compound interest refers to the process where interest is calculated not only on the initial principal but also on the accumulated interest from previous periods. This concept is particularly common in investment contexts, but it can also apply to certain types of loans. Importance in Loan Repayment Calculations ● Helps in cost estimation: A compound interest calculator plays a critical role in understanding how compound interest impacts loan repayments. ● Shows real repayment amounts: While simple interest results in linear growth, compound interest leads to exponential growth of debt, which can substantially increase total repayment amounts over time. By using a compound interest calculator, borrowers can better predict the true costs associated with loans carrying compound interest conditions.
